Types of Glass: Exploring Varieties for Your Home’s Entrance

Choosing the perfect glass for your new glass front door can be exciting, but with so many options, it can also feel overwhelming.  Clear glass is a timeless favorite for a reason – it offers an unbeatable combination of clean lines and an open feel, allowing natural light to flow into your entryway. However, those seeking more privacy might opt for textured, frosted, or decorative Glass, which can obscure the view while allowing natural light to pass through. Stained glass features add an artistic touch and can be customized to reflect personal tastes or complement architectural styles. Understanding the differences between these types and the maintenance each will require will guide you in deciding to suit your lifestyle and home’s design.

Balancing Privacy and Natural Light in Your Foyer

The entryway to your home is a transitional space where the need for privacy and the desire for natural light must be carefully balanced. Glass with frosted or etched finishes offers the perfect solution to this challenge, radiating a soft glow that maintains discretion. Innovations in glass manufacturing have also led to products that can switch from transparent to opaque, providing control over privacy at the flip of a switch. The strategic use of such Glass ensures that your home remains a private sanctuary while still feeling bright and open.

Thermal Efficiency and Glass: Keeping Your Home Comfortable

The thermal properties of the Glass in your entry door should be noted. Energy-efficient glass options can dramatically reduce your home’s thermal transfer, creating a barrier between the external climate and your comfortable interior. Modern innovations such as double or triple-paned glass units with low-emissivity coatings and insulating gases help you control energy costs while preserving an environmentally friendly home. Understanding the insulating properties of various glass types is critical to selecting one that aligns with sustainability goals and provides year-round comfort. Enhancing Security with Glass Choices for Entry Doors

In addition to aesthetic considerations, the security aspects of Glass are paramount. Innovation in glass technology has introduced features that enhance the safety of your home without compromising style. Tempered Glass, for example, is designed to shatter into harmless granules upon impact, reducing the risk of injury. Laminated Glass contains an interlayer that holds the Glass together if broken, providing a deterrent to potential intruders. A layer of security can be added to your home by considering the strength and resilience of your chosen Glass.

The Legal Considerations of Glass Doors: Navigating Building Codes

Your choice of Glass for an entry door must also consider the building codes and regulations set forth by local governments. These often dictate the permissible glass types to ensure safety and energy efficiency. Compliance with these standards means following the law and protecting your home by adhering to accepted practices. Understanding the applicable codes is a step towards making a safe and sound investment in your door’s glass components.
